Enjoy the warm and rich flavors of Crock Pot Apple Cider Pork Roast. Apple cider adds sweetness to this easy and tasty dish, and slow-cooked pork makes it tender and delicious.
Ingredients: 3-4 lbs pork shoulder roast. 1 cup apple cider. 1/2 cup chicken broth. 1/4 cup soy sauce. 1/4 cup brown sugar, packed. 1 onion, thinly sliced. 4 cloves garlic, minced. 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ard. 1 teaspoon dried thyme. 1 teaspoon rosemary, chopped. 1/2 teaspoon black pepper. 2 tablespoons cornstarch for optional thickening. 2 tablespoons water for optional thickening.
Instructions: Put the roast pork shoulder in the crock pot. Apple cider, chicken broth, soy sauce, brown sugar, dijon mustard, dried thyme, chopped rosemary, and black pepper should all be mixed together in a bowl. Combine well. Spread the apple cider mix on top of the pork in the crockpot. Keep the lid on and cook on low for 7 to 8 hours, or until the pork is soft and can be shred with a fork. If you want the sauce to be thicker, you can make a slurry by mixing cornstarch and water. At the end of the cooking time, stir the slurry into the crockpot. After the pork is cooked, use two forks to shred it and mix it with the tasty sauce. You can put the Apple Cider Pork Roast in the crock pot and serve it over rice, mashed potatoes, or in sandwiches. Enjoy this tender and tasty pork roast that has been flavored with sweet and savory apple cider.
Prep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 480 minutes
